How can vinegar enhance the flavor of sandwiches?

Vinegar can enhance the flavor of sandwiches by adding a tangy and acidic taste that balances out the richness of other ingredients, such as meats and cheeses. It can also help to brighten and intensify the overall flavor profile of the sandwich.
